TGS: Look at all these freakin’ people

See all of these people in the above picture? This is just the small walkway between the two main hallways at Makuhari Messe, home of the 2010 Tokyo Game Show. Can you believe that crap? I walked in the middle of this earlier today, smelling smells and seeing sights I never expected to smell or see. I was frustrated and cranky walking through it, but finding this spot later and seeing it from above, I was amazed.

If that doesn’t impress you, check out the IRL Cho Aniki in our gallery below. I found this in a garden about 5 minutes away from the TGS front doors. Amazing.

Dale North